From fe44022dc45d4286254c9e31d8a6ce4af9b48522 Mon Sep 17 00:00:00 2001 From: sam_marshall Date: Fri, 19 Dec 2008 12:19:36 +0000 Subject: [PATCH] MDL-15499 Fix to conditional availability: list of activities for completion included those with completion turned off --- course/moodleform_mod.php | 4 +++- 1 file changed, 3 insertions(+), 1 deletion(-) diff --git a/course/moodleform_mod.php b/course/moodleform_mod.php index 976e3edb28..3507f28c97 100644 --- a/course/moodleform_mod.php +++ b/course/moodleform_mod.php @@ -434,7 +434,9 @@ class moodleform_mod extends moodleform { $completionoptions=array(); $modinfo=get_fast_modinfo($COURSE); foreach($modinfo->cms as $id=>$cm) { - $completionoptions[$id]=$cm->name; + if($cm->completion) { + $completionoptions[$id]=$cm->name; + } } asort($completionoptions); $completionoptions=array(0=>get_string('none','condition'))+$completionoptions; -- 2.39.5